Outline (in English)

1. Course Outline

This seminar is for students at first grade of master course. Students will analyze some famous theses in the field of labor law and some cases of labor law.


2. Learning Objectives

By the end of the course, students should be able to do the followings:
-A. Advanced necessary for setting the theme of a master's thesis and writing a dissertation on a specific theme while acquiring accurate understanding of the latest major problems of labor law, problem-seeking, application of theory, and problem-solving ability. To acquire the methods and techniques of. Particular emphasis is placed on comparative law research.
-B. Students who participated in this class will write their own thoughts on various issues related to labor law as a dissertation by acquiring a high level of understanding and application of the basic theory of and labor law.


3. Learning Activities Outside of Classroom

Lecture/Exercise(two-credits)
Before/after each class meeting, students will be expected to spend five hours to understand the course content.


4.Grading Criteria /Policies

Your overall grade in the class will be decided based on the following:
-a. Quality of student reports: 50%
-b. Learning results for problems pointed out by the instructor: 50%
